Category Schools - SLPA Job Type Contract Take your passion for helping students succeed to the next level in this exciting full-time Speech-Language Pathology Assistant (SLPA) contract opportunity for the 2026-2027 academic year. As a valued contributor, you'll support students' communication development across all grade levels, making a meaningful impact in their lives. This position offers a consistent 32.5-hour workweek, providing stability while allowing you to build strong, ongoing relationships with students, families, and educational teams. You'll work collaboratively with experienced Speech-Language Pathologists and fellow support staff in a friendly, inclusive school setting.
Ideal candidates will bring:
An active SLPA license/certification in Missouri (or eligibility for one) Experience providing therapy in school settings is preferred, though strong new graduates are encouraged to apply Adaptability and enthusiasm for working with diverse student populations across a range of age groups and needs Solid communication and documentation skills Collaborative spirit to work seamlessly alongside educators, therapists, and families As the SLPA, your responsibilities will include: Delivering direct and indirect speech-language services under the supervision of an SLP Supporting individualized education programs (IEPs) by implementing planned interventions Monitoring student progress and collecting data for SLP review Assisting with screenings and preparing age-appropriate therapy materials Participating in team meetings, trainings, and district initiatives as needed In this role, you'll contribute to a supportive team environment that values professional growth and student-focused collaboration.
